TABLE HELP PATH

Three Ways We Resolve Table Issues

A stalled Live Blackjack Salon screen needs a clear route, especially when a hand is already in progress.

Dealer stream stalls Refresh the Live Blackjack Salon page and confirm whether the table reconnects before opening a support request. If it does not, share the table name and the approximate round time through the account help path.
Action control is unavailable Check the rule card and your current hand first, because table rules determine which actions appear. If the displayed control does not match the table state, contact us with a screen capture and table label.
Account cannot enter the table Complete the clear phone verification step from your account area, then return to the live lobby. If Salon entry remains blocked, use account help so we can check the access status for that table session.

Live Blackjack Salon is our dealer-led blackjack room, where you see a live table feed, your cards, and the available hand controls on one screen. Open it from the live lobby after completing the phone verification connected to your account.

Log in, complete phone verification when prompted, and select the Live Blackjack Salon tile in the live lobby. Check the table card before joining, because it identifies the table conditions and available blackjack actions for that session.

Depending on the table rules and your current hand, the screen can present Hit, Stand, Double, or Split. Read the rule card before joining and check the active controls during the decision window, as not every action applies to every hand.

Yes, open the browser lobby on a current phone and select the Salon tile. The dealer feed, cards, and touch controls are arranged for a smaller screen; landscape orientation can provide a wider view of the table.

A table may be between rounds, full, reconnecting, or unavailable for your account because access depends on local law. Refresh the live-table page first, then use account help with the table name if the issue remains.

We do not show one fixed RTP figure for every Live Blackjack Salon table. Blackjack outcomes and available decisions follow the table rules, so check the visible rule card for the specific session before you select a stake.

Use our account help path and provide the Live Blackjack Salon table name, approximate round time, and a screen capture if available. We use those session details to locate the table state and assess the reported hand question.
